My friend was visiting from out of state and we purchased a bus ticket for her return home. At the time of departure, the bus was scheduled to pick up in a parking lot and was 20 minutes late. Unfortunately, we were unaware that she needed to download the ticket in advance, and her phone became unusable due to data issues. There was no kiosk available in the parking lot, and the driver was unhelpful, refusing to let her board. As a result, she missed the bus, and my 45-year-old friend is still stranded here. We contacted the company after the incident and were informed that nothing could be done. We've reached out to local churches and assistance organizations, but none have funds available for a bus ticket. We're out of options, and her father is seriously ill, adding to the urgency of her situation. Be cautious if you're boarding in a parking lot without a printed ticket, as they will not accommodate you.

Greyhound’s iconic brand is synonymous with affordable long distance travel in North America and a unique national network.
Founded in 1914, Greyhound Lines, Inc. is the largest provider of intercity bus transportation, serving more than 3,800 destinations across North America with a modern, environmentally friendly fleet. It has become an American icon, providing safe, enjoyable and affordable travel to nearly 18 million passengers each year in the United States and Canada. See more
